Our alumni have launched 30 social ventures including:
• Cracked It, the tech repair service staffed by ex-gang members. Social Enterprise of the Year 2018 and 2019.
• Birdsong the feminist fashion brand selling wardrobe stapes made by women paid a fair wage. Featured in Vogue, Dazed and Vice.
• Appt, a HealthTech business that uses behavioural economics to help patients manage their long-term conditions – with multi-year investment from Innovate UK.
• Chatterbox, an online language tuition platform powered by refugee talent, featured in The Economist, Tech Crunch and The Times.
